""" VOoM markup mode for VimOutliner format. See |voom_mode_vimoutliner|, ../../doc/voom.txt#*voom_mode_vimoutliner* Headlines are lines with >=0 Tabs followed by any character except: : ; | > < Otherwise this mode is identical to the "thevimoutliner" mode.
